📝 Ingredients
Dark Chocolate (unsweetened Chocolate, Sugar, Cocoa Butter, Soy Lecithin (an Emulsifier), Vanilla), Raisins, Confectioner's Glaze.

💬 Nutrition Q&A: Dierberg's Dark Chocolate-Covered Raisins
Is Dierberg's Dark Chocolate-Covered Raisins good for weight loss?
These chocolate-covered raisins are calorie-dense at 180 calories per serving, making them easy to overeat. While they do contain 3g of fiber and some protein, the high sugar content (17g per serving) means they're best enjoyed occasionally and in measured portions if you're watching your weight.
How might Dierberg's Dark Chocolate-Covered Raisins affect blood sugar?
With 17g of sugar and only 3g of fiber, these will likely cause a noticeable blood sugar spike. The dark chocolate may provide some antioxidants, but the high sugar content outweighs any potential benefit for blood sugar stability.
Is Dierberg's Dark Chocolate-Covered Raisins heart-healthy?
The 6g of saturated fat per serving is a consideration for heart health, though dark chocolate does contain compounds with potential cardiovascular benefits. You'd want to account for this snack within your daily saturated fat limits.
Is Dierberg's Dark Chocolate-Covered Raisins suitable for people with lactose intolerance?
Dark chocolate and raisins are naturally dairy-free, and the ingredients listed don't include milk products, making this suitable for people with lactose intolerance.
What should I watch out for with Dierberg's Dark Chocolate-Covered Raisins?
The main concern is the sugar load—17g per serving is substantial. If you're sensitive to caffeine, dark chocolate does contain some. The soy lecithin is worth noting if you have a soy allergy.
